179 /*
180  * The global network interface list (V_ifnet) and related state (such as
181  * if_index, if_indexlim, and ifindex_table) are protected by an sxlock and
182  * an rwlock.  Either may be acquired shared to stablize the list, but both
183  * must be acquired writable to modify the list.  This model allows us to
184  * both stablize the interface list during interrupt thread processing, but
185  * also to stablize it over long-running ioctls, without introducing priority
186  * inversions and deadlocks.
187  */
188 struct rwlock ifnet_rwlock;
189 struct sx ifnet_sxlock;
190 
191 /*
192  * The allocation of network interfaces is a rather non-atomic affair; we
193  * need to select an index before we are ready to expose the interface for
194  * use, so will use this pointer value to indicate reservation.
195  */
196 #define	IFNET_HOLD	(void *)(uintptr_t)(-1)

1852 /*
1853  * Handle a change in the interface link state. To avoid LORs
1854  * between driver lock and upper layer locks, as well as possible
1855  * recursions, we post event to taskqueue, and all job
1856  * is done in static do_link_state_change().
1857  */
1858 void
1859 if_link_state_change(struct ifnet *ifp, int link_state)
1860 {
1861 	/* Return if state hasn't changed. */
1862 	if (ifp->if_link_state == link_state)
1863 		return;
1864 
1865 	ifp->if_link_state = link_state;
1866 
1867 	taskqueue_enqueue(taskqueue_swi, &ifp->if_linktask);
1868 }
1869 
1870 static void
1871 do_link_state_change(void *arg, int pending)
1872 {
1873 	struct ifnet *ifp = (struct ifnet *)arg;
1874 	int link_state = ifp->if_link_state;
1875 	CURVNET_SET(ifp->if_vnet);
1876 
1877 	/* Notify that the link state has changed. */
1878 	rt_ifmsg(ifp);
1879 	if (ifp->if_vlantrunk != NULL)
1880 		(*vlan_link_state_p)(ifp);
1881 
1882 	if ((ifp->if_type == IFT_ETHER || ifp->if_type == IFT_L2VLAN) &&
1883 	    IFP2AC(ifp)->ac_netgraph != NULL)
1884 		(*ng_ether_link_state_p)(ifp, link_state);
1885 #if defined(INET) || defined(INET6)
1886 #ifdef DEV_CARP
1887 	if (ifp->if_carp)
1888 		carp_carpdev_state(ifp->if_carp);
1889 #endif
1890 #endif
1891 	if (ifp->if_bridge) {
1892 		KASSERT(bstp_linkstate_p != NULL,("if_bridge bstp not loaded!"));
1893 		(*bstp_linkstate_p)(ifp, link_state);
1894 	}
1895 	if (ifp->if_lagg) {
1896 		KASSERT(lagg_linkstate_p != NULL,("if_lagg not loaded!"));
1897 		(*lagg_linkstate_p)(ifp, link_state);
1898 	}
1899 
1900 	if (IS_DEFAULT_VNET(curvnet))
1901 		devctl_notify("IFNET", ifp->if_xname,
1902 		    (link_state == LINK_STATE_UP) ? "LINK_UP" : "LINK_DOWN",
1903 		    NULL);
1904 	if (pending > 1)
1905 		if_printf(ifp, "%d link states coalesced\n", pending);
1906 	if (log_link_state_change)
1907 		log(LOG_NOTICE, "%s: link state changed to %s\n", ifp->if_xname,
1908 		    (link_state == LINK_STATE_UP) ? "UP" : "DOWN" );
1909 	CURVNET_RESTORE();
1910 }

2851 /*
2852  * Register an additional multicast address with a network interface.
2853  *
2854  * - If the address is already present, bump the reference count on the
2855  *   address and return.
2856  * - If the address is not link-layer, look up a link layer address.
2857  * - Allocate address structures for one or both addresses, and attach to the
2858  *   multicast address list on the interface.  If automatically adding a link
2859  *   layer address, the protocol address will own a reference to the link
2860  *   layer address, to be freed when it is freed.
2861  * - Notify the network device driver of an addition to the multicast address
2862  *   list.
2863  *
2864  * 'sa' points to caller-owned memory with the desired multicast address.
2865  *
2866  * 'retifma' will be used to return a pointer to the resulting multicast
2867  * address reference, if desired.
2868  */
2869 int
2870 if_addmulti(struct ifnet *ifp, struct sockaddr *sa,
2871     struct ifmultiaddr **retifma)
2872 {
2873 	struct ifmultiaddr *ifma, *ll_ifma;
2874 	struct sockaddr *llsa;
2875 	int error;
2876 
2877 	/*
2878 	 * If the address is already present, return a new reference to it;
2879 	 * otherwise, allocate storage and set up a new address.
2880 	 */
2881 	IF_ADDR_LOCK(ifp);
2882 	ifma = if_findmulti(ifp, sa);
2883 	if (ifma != NULL) {
2884 		ifma->ifma_refcount++;
2885 		if (retifma != NULL)
2886 			*retifma = ifma;
2887 		IF_ADDR_UNLOCK(ifp);
2888 		return (0);
2889 	}
2890 
2891 	/*
2892 	 * The address isn't already present; resolve the protocol address
2893 	 * into a link layer address, and then look that up, bump its
2894 	 * refcount or allocate an ifma for that also.  If 'llsa' was
2895 	 * returned, we will need to free it later.
2896 	 */
2897 	llsa = NULL;
2898 	ll_ifma = NULL;
2899 	if (ifp->if_resolvemulti != NULL) {
2900 		error = ifp->if_resolvemulti(ifp, &llsa, sa);
2901 		if (error)
2902 			goto unlock_out;
2903 	}
2904 
2905 	/*
2906 	 * Allocate the new address.  Don't hook it up yet, as we may also
2907 	 * need to allocate a link layer multicast address.
2908 	 */
2909 	ifma = if_allocmulti(ifp, sa, llsa, M_NOWAIT);
2910 	if (ifma == NULL) {
2911 		error = ENOMEM;
2912 		goto free_llsa_out;
2913 	}
2914 
2915 	/*
2916 	 * If a link layer address is found, we'll need to see if it's
2917 	 * already present in the address list, or allocate is as well.
2918 	 * When this block finishes, the link layer address will be on the
2919 	 * list.
2920 	 */
2921 	if (llsa != NULL) {
2922 		ll_ifma = if_findmulti(ifp, llsa);
2923 		if (ll_ifma == NULL) {
2924 			ll_ifma = if_allocmulti(ifp, llsa, NULL, M_NOWAIT);
2925 			if (ll_ifma == NULL) {
2926 				--ifma->ifma_refcount;
2927 				if_freemulti(ifma);
2928 				error = ENOMEM;
2929 				goto free_llsa_out;
2930 			}
2931 			TAILQ_INSERT_HEAD(&ifp->if_multiaddrs, ll_ifma,
2932 			    ifma_link);
2933 		} else
2934 			ll_ifma->ifma_refcount++;
2935 		ifma->ifma_llifma = ll_ifma;
2936 	}
2937 
2938 	/*
2939 	 * We now have a new multicast address, ifma, and possibly a new or
2940 	 * referenced link layer address.  Add the primary address to the
2941 	 * ifnet address list.
2942 	 */
2943 	TAILQ_INSERT_HEAD(&ifp->if_multiaddrs, ifma, ifma_link);
2944 
2945 	if (retifma != NULL)
2946 		*retifma = ifma;
2947 
2948 	/*
2949 	 * Must generate the message while holding the lock so that 'ifma'
2950 	 * pointer is still valid.
2951 	 */
2952 	rt_newmaddrmsg(RTM_NEWMADDR, ifma);
2953 	IF_ADDR_UNLOCK(ifp);
2954 
2955 	/*
2956 	 * We are certain we have added something, so call down to the
2957 	 * interface to let them know about it.
2958 	 */
2959 	if (ifp->if_ioctl != NULL) {
2960 		(void) (*ifp->if_ioctl)(ifp, SIOCADDMULTI, 0);
2961 	}
2962 
2963 	if (llsa != NULL)
2964 		free(llsa, M_IFMADDR);
2965 
2966 	return (0);
2967 
2968 free_llsa_out:
2969 	if (llsa != NULL)
2970 		free(llsa, M_IFMADDR);
2971 
2972 unlock_out:
2973 	IF_ADDR_UNLOCK(ifp);
2974 	return (error);
2975 }

3091 /*
3092  * Perform deletion of network-layer and/or link-layer multicast address.
3093  *
3094  * Return 0 if the reference count was decremented.
3095  * Return 1 if the final reference was released, indicating that the
3096  * hardware hash filter should be reprogrammed.
3097  */
3098 static int
3099 if_delmulti_locked(struct ifnet *ifp, struct ifmultiaddr *ifma, int detaching)
3100 {
3101 	struct ifmultiaddr *ll_ifma;
3102 
3103 	if (ifp != NULL && ifma->ifma_ifp != NULL) {
3104 		KASSERT(ifma->ifma_ifp == ifp,
3105 		    ("%s: inconsistent ifp %p", __func__, ifp));
3106 		IF_ADDR_LOCK_ASSERT(ifp);
3107 	}
3108 
3109 	ifp = ifma->ifma_ifp;
3110 
3111 	/*
3112 	 * If the ifnet is detaching, null out references to ifnet,
3113 	 * so that upper protocol layers will notice, and not attempt
3114 	 * to obtain locks for an ifnet which no longer exists. The
3115 	 * routing socket announcement must happen before the ifnet
3116 	 * instance is detached from the system.
3117 	 */
3118 	if (detaching) {
3119 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
3120 		printf("%s: detaching ifnet instance %p\n", __func__, ifp);
3121 #endif
3122 		/*
3123 		 * ifp may already be nulled out if we are being reentered
3124 		 * to delete the ll_ifma.
3125 		 */
3126 		if (ifp != NULL) {
3127 			rt_newmaddrmsg(RTM_DELMADDR, ifma);
3128 			ifma->ifma_ifp = NULL;
3129 		}
3130 	}
3131 
3132 	if (--ifma->ifma_refcount > 0)
3133 		return 0;
3134 
3135 	/*
3136 	 * If this ifma is a network-layer ifma, a link-layer ifma may
3137 	 * have been associated with it. Release it first if so.
3138 	 */
3139 	ll_ifma = ifma->ifma_llifma;
3140 	if (ll_ifma != NULL) {
3141 		KASSERT(ifma->ifma_lladdr != NULL,
3142 		    ("%s: llifma w/o lladdr", __func__));
3143 		if (detaching)
3144 			ll_ifma->ifma_ifp = NULL;	/* XXX */
3145 		if (--ll_ifma->ifma_refcount == 0) {
3146 			if (ifp != NULL) {
3147 				TAILQ_REMOVE(&ifp->if_multiaddrs, ll_ifma,
3148 				    ifma_link);
3149 			}
3150 			if_freemulti(ll_ifma);
3151 		}
3152 	}
3153 
3154 	if (ifp != NULL)
3155 		TAILQ_REMOVE(&ifp->if_multiaddrs, ifma, ifma_link);
3156 
3157 	if_freemulti(ifma);
3158 
3159 	/*
3160 	 * The last reference to this instance of struct ifmultiaddr
3161 	 * was released; the hardware should be notified of this change.
3162 	 */
3163 	return 1;
3164 }
